I bought a replacement LED Driver that i thought would do the job but nothing. Ive test the leds all ok, input to driver ok but cant get a reading on the output of the driver. Am i setting the multimeter wrong?

Have i got the wrong led driver?

Or is the new driver faulty too?

New. Driver output: DC45v/0.35A cc
Old. 350ma cc P rated 12.95W

Thanks.
 
what's the output voltage on the old driver?
 
might just be that the new driver has insufficient voltage output. had similar, old driver was 85V max. a 80V max driver would not work. a 90A driver was fine.
